A twisting read and great introduction to this world that does have a number of moving pieces to it that can be a bit hard to keep track of.
The voice of Peter is consistently recognized as a science-users approach to magic whose mind wanders a lot. The illustrations were a welcome surprise. I did find myself thinking "Wait, who was that?" a bit too much; perhaps my sign to start keeping character indexes.
